New Orleans, best month
Looking to book a trip to New Orleans this year. Any suggestions as to the best month to travel? Weather.com states that Oct is best, but isn't that during hurricain season?

Yes, October is in hurricane season, but the odds of being there during a hurricane are extremely small. The hurricane season doesn't end until the end of November, but if bad weather (a hurricane) develops you'll have several days before it goes aground.
In general, I'd say that the best weather in NO is either spring or fall. Late summer is perfectly miserable - high temps and higher humidity.

There's not a bad month to visit NOLA. Some are busy and some are hot. Some are chilly and some are not busy. Here's a link to NOLA events. Pick a month that's not busy and check room rates. I love January. Nothing is going on. The spring has MG and a lot of festivals as well as conventions. The summer is hot and quiet. That does not bother me it's hot at home. Just pick a time when room rates are reasonable and you will enjoy your visit.
